Michael, to tell you the truth. Tegus are the only reptile that I know of that the egg builds up pressure during incubation. Tegu eggs start off soft and dented, as the progress they get more firm. When the hatchling cuts the shell, fluid squirts out of the egg. That is why the egg appears small.
